The Intersect Group has an employee rating of 3.4 out of 5 stars, based on 277 company reviews on Glassdoor which indicates that most employees have a good working experience there. The The Intersect Group employee rating is in line with the average (within 1 standard deviation) for employers within the Human Resources & Staffing industry (3.8 stars).

Look I'm going to be as real as possible because I have nothing to lose. This company does not care about you. They might make it look that way but go to LinkedIn look at the tenure of the "Recruiters" or "sales Managers" who have TIG listed on their jobs. IT IS NOT LONG. In fact it is probably the most unsettling tenure I've ever seen in my professional career. A LOT OF PEOPLE DON'T MAKE IT EVEN 1 YEAR. Additionally, this company is an energy vampire. I became a different, unhappy person when I worked here. I was micromanaged like crazy and I never felt good enough. They expect you to work hard to prove yourself but if you're a recruiter you'll never be valued the way the sales people are. They say you're equal but right off the bat sales people are paid more and have a higher compensation plan. If you're reading this review you are probably fresh out of college because my manager literally told our team "we won't take referrals, we only want people with no experience who won't ask for a higher salary" RED FLAG. They're gonna try to pay you $45k salary and 2% commission in the R1 position. Then take your commission away and make you restart when you're promoted and start paying you a whopping 3% in commission!! WOW! Good luck finding a job but just think twice about if you want this one... also the benefits suck. PS. the company asks employees to write good reviews so take those with a grain of salt. In fact, take this with a grain of salt, reach out to some past employees on LinkedIn and Ask them personally what their experience was like. Just do your research..
